Choosing the Perfect Sod: Types, Longevity, and Aesthetics
Though appearance is important, you'll choose sod by matching species and cultivar traits to Fayetteville's transition-zone climate and your site's use profile. For full sun and high traffic, consider hybrid bermudagrass (Cynodon dactylon × C. transvaalensis) with delicate texture, fast stolon/rhizome spread, and excellent wear tolerance. Zoysia (Zoysia japonica, Z. matrella) delivers dense turf, slower growth, and cold resilience; opt for drought-tolerant cultivars with documented ET reduction. For areas with limited sunlight, St. Augustine (Stenotaphrum secundatum) and shade-resistant blends of zoysia exceed bermuda. Tall fescue (Festuca arundinacea) mixed with Kentucky bluegrass adds cool-season color but may decline in summer heat without irrigation. Evaluate disease resistance (brown patch, spring dead spot), thatch propensity, and leaf blade width. Match sod to soil pH, drainage class, and intended use intensity.

Sustainable Methods That Save Water and Boost Soil Health
Once installation and maintenance protocols set up, you can now enhance inputs with practices that save water and build resilient soil architecture. Install smart irrigation with evapotranspiration-based scheduling and matched-precipitation nozzles to minimize runoff and deep percolation. Set precipitation rates to soil infiltration capacity, then irrigate to field capacity, not saturation.
Deploy mulch layers 2-3 inches deep using shredded hardwood or pine straw to suppress evaporation, moderate soil temperature, and promote mycorrhizal networks. Incorporate compost at 5-10% by volume to boost cation exchange capacity and microbial biomass, enhancing aggregate stability.
Design rain gardens in downhill areas to collect rooftop and lawn runoff; configure basins for one-inch storm events and plant deep-rooted graminoids and facultative perennials. Aerate compacted zones, then dress with screened compost to reestablish drainage and moisture check here retention.
